How they compare
Sri Lanka currently reports 0.6686 against 0.5186 in Oceania (UNSDG), a difference of 0.15.
That makes Sri Lanka's figure about 1.3 times Oceania (UNSDG)'s.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Sri Lanka ahead.
Oceania (UNSDG) ranks 20th and Sri Lanka ranks 22nd of 58 groups.
Sri Lanka has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
